Apple has previewed the upcoming iOS 16 and iPadOS 16 at the WWDC 2022. The new software is expected to introduce various features such as re-imagined Lock Screen, iCloud Shared Photo Library, Stage Manager and updates to both Mail and Messages to compatible iPhones and iPads. Both software models will be available later this year as a free update for eligible devices.

iOS 16

Lock Screen, Focus, Apple Pay Later and More

The upcoming iOS 16 will deliver a new and reimagined Lock Screen to iPhones. Users will be able to create, customise and personalise different elements of the lock screen to their preference. The wallpaper can be customised with complementing filters, backgrounds, colour and font for the date and time. Apple has also introduced a new wallpaper gallery to inspire options, added widgets to the lock screen and users can create multiple lock screens for different purposes.

Notifications has been redesigned to roll in from the bottom of the lock screen and with Live Activities, users can stay up to date with real-time events such as a live game score, track the progress of an Uber ride and play/control music. Focus has also been extended to the lock screen, allowing users to dedicate a lock screen (wallpaper and widgets) to a particular focus activity and with Focus Filters, certain apps will only show relevant content to the activated Focus mode.

There are also enhanced intelligence and communication features such as Edit, Undo Send and Mark Conversations as Unread in Messages; SharePlay in Messages; new dictation features that allows switching between voice and touch; and Live Text in Video. Wallet has added Apple Pay Order Tracking to track purchases made through Apple Pay and Apple Pay Later for users to make payments in four equal instalments. There is also expanded support for Keys in Wallet.

Other highlighted iOS features include the addition of multistep routing to Apple Maps, updates to Family Sharing, iCloud Shared Photo Library, improved search in Mail, new Safety Check in Settings to access and reset the permissions granted to others and support for the new Matter smart home connectivity standard, which allows smart accessories to connect across platforms.

iPadOS 16

Stage Manager, iCloud Shared Photo Library and More

There are new ways in Messages to collaborate and manage shared content across Apple apps such as Files, Notes, Pages, and Safari, as well as third-party apps. A new app called FreeForm, available later this year on iOS, iPadOS and macOS, will provide the necessary tools to collaborate and brainstorm ideas live on a FaceTime call.

Stage Manager takes the versatility and multitasking on the iPad to another level and supports full external display support. The feature organises apps and windows, making it easy to access them whilst focusing on the one in use. It also brings overlapping windows to the iPad for the first time and unlocks the full capability of the full external display with support for up to 6K resolution and work with up to 8 apps simultaneously.

With iPadOS 16, the iPad will also get the best of iOS 16 and macOS Ventura features such as Shared Photo Library, Shared Tab Groups and Passkeys in Safari, various updates to Mail and Weather is also coming to the iPad, taking advantage of the fullscreen.
